A Senior Manager Sourcing is responsible for overseeing the sourcing and procurement of goods and services for an organization. They are responsible for developing and executing sourcing strategies, negotiating contracts, managing supplier relationships, and ensuring compliance with company policies and procedures. They must have str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ills, as well as a thorough understanding of the industry and the organization’s needs. To become a Senior Manager Sourcing, one must have a bachelor’s degree in a related field, such as business, economics, or finance, and several years of experience in procurement and sourcing.
